3,194,272,498,009 is an odd composite number composed of two prime numbers multiplied together.

What does the number 3194272498009 look like?

This visualization shows the relationship between its 2 prime factors (large circles) and 4 divisors.

3194272498009 is an odd composite number. It is composed of two dist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of four divisors.

Prime factorization of 3194272498009:

84713 × 37706993
